Default Column widths looking different in different files.

I have 2 Excel files (Excel 2003, in Windows XP), which should look visually
the same, although the actual content varies a little bit. In one of the
files, a column width = 11 is about 50% wider than the 11 in the other file.

I have verified that all of the settings I can check are the same:
Zoom is 100% on both
Default font is the same, font used in the actual page is the same
Everything under Tools-Options is the same (same items checked, etc.)

I tried copying the content from the wider file to a new worksheet, but it's
still wide. I don't want it wide.
